Alto one-person is a semi-freestanding tent perfect for the weight-conscious solo backpacker who still wants a high degree of livability in their shelter.
The revolutionary Tension Ridge architecture of the Alto allows for taller oversized doors and vertical walls that create an unrivalled amount of space. Apex Vents positioned at the highest point of the tent effectively expel moist air and minimize condensation, and the variable rainfly can be rolled back on both sides for stargazing, then deployed quickly from inside the tent.

TECHNICAL FEATURES

The poles of the Tension Ridge are swept upwards like the dihedral wing of an airplane – not angled downwards as is common in tents. This raises the tent’s shape, providing significantly more head and shoulder room, higher doors, easier access and more usable vestibule space.

Typical of Sea to Summit’s commitment to refining details to make gear frictionless and more functional, these machined aluminum clips make setting up the rainfly (either with the inner tent, or with a footprint in ultralight configuration) quick and easy. And they are far more durable than plastic buckles.

Every Sea to Summit tent packs up into three stuff sacks to allow you to split the load easily. During setup, two stuff sacks transform into gear storage pockets, while the pole stuff sack (with a translucent diffuser) becomes a Lightbar. Add a headlamp or two for soft illumination throughout the tent.

Mounted at the highest point, Apex Vents allow warm moist air to escape and channel fresh air into the tent. The vent can easily be zipped shut from inside the tent and does not require mesh to retain its shape, significantly improving airflow. Baseline Vent allows you to control humidity in wet conditions by opening or closing lower portion of the door while maintaining vestibule function and rain protection for your gear.

Frequently Asked questions
Will a 200 x 64 cm pad fit in this tent?
You can just squeeze a large rectangular pad into the Alto TR 1 (it was primarily designed for ultralight backpackers who generally use smaller pads).
Worth the weight difference over a bivy shelter?
We think so. The Alto gives you room to sit up, excellent ventilation (so almost no condensation) and a vestibule to store wet gear - all of which you won't have in a bivy shelter.
Do I need to use a footprint with this tent?
The Alto has a very light floor, waterproof to 1200mm. It can be used on wet grass/undergrowth without a footprint. However, a footprint will protect the floor from damage on abrasive surfaces.
